(This note is not part of the Regulations)
These Regulations amend the Feedingstuffs (Zootechnical Products) Regulations 1999 by introducing a Community method of analysis for the determination of lasalocid sodium in feedingstuffs, in implementation, in relation to zootechnical additives and products with zootechnical additives in them, of Commission Directive 1999/76/EC (OJ No. L207, 6.8.1999, p. 13).
The Feedingstuffs (Zootechnical Products) Regulations 1999 implemented, in relation to such additives and products, a number of Community instruments including in particular Council Directive 70/524/EEC (OJ No. L270, 14.12.70, p. 1, OJ/SE Vol. 18, p. 4), with amendments up to and including those effected by Council Directive 96/51/EEC (OJ No. L235, 17.9.96, p. 39), on additives in feedingstuffs, and Council Directive 95/69/EC (OJ No. L332, 30.12.95, p. 15) which lay down the conditions and arrangements for approving and registering certain establishments and intermediaries operating in the animal feed sector.
These Regulations also bring cross-references in the Medicated Feedingstuffs Regulations 1998 up to date.
